Reds Like Gotham's Kids

The Reds are said to looking to move Adam Dunn, and if they are, it appears that they have interest in both the Mets and Yankees' young prospects.

Their logic? Both the Mets and Yankees have expressed an interest in the young slugger in the past, and while they haven’t in awhile, one industry source stated Wednesday that “(the Mets and Yankees) are going to find that teams are going to be very difficult to deal with this offseason. (Dunn) might be a guy they consider when they realize what’s out there, and what it’s going to cost.”

The Reds are most interested in young arms and players that are contact-type hitters, guys who project to strikeout less than 90-100 times a season, but show the ability to produce runs. The club is also trying to improve its overall defense.
